How much do learning development program man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 9, 2026, the average yearly pay for learning development program manager in Indiana is $91,514.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$79,000.00 and $100,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Learning Development Program Manager vs Training Coordinator?

AspectLearning Development Program ManagerTraining Coordinator
ResponsibilitiesDesigning, implementing, and overseeing learning programs and development initiativesOrganizing and scheduling training sessions, managing logistics
Required SkillsCurriculum design, project management, leadershipCommunication, organization, coordination
CertificationsLearning & Development certifications (e.g., CPLP), project managementTraining certifications, CPR/First Aid (if applicable)
Work EnvironmentCorporate training departments, educational institutionsHR departments, training centers

The Learning Development Program Manager focuses on creating and managing comprehensive learning strategies, while the Training Coordinator handles the logistics of training sessions. Both roles require strong organizational skills, but the Program Manager typically has a broader scope and strategic responsibilities.

What is a Learning Development Program Manager?

A Learning Development Program Manager is a professional responsible for designing, implementing, and managing training and development programs within an organization. They assess the learning needs of employees, create educational materials or programs, and measure the effectiveness of training initiatives. Their goal is to enhance employee skills, improve job performance, and support organizational growth by fostering a culture of continuous learning.

How does a Learning Development Program Manager typically collaborate with subject matter experts to create effective training programs?

Learning Development Program Managers often work closely with subject matter experts (SMEs) to ensure that training content is accurate, relevant, and aligned with organizational goals. This collaboration usually involves conducting needs assessments, co-designing curriculum, and reviewing training materials for technical accuracy. Program Managers facilitate regular meetings and feedback sessions with SMEs to refine content and adapt to learner feedback. Building strong relationships and clear communication with SMEs is key to delivering impactful learning experiences.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Learning Development Program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Learning Development Program Manager, you need expertise in instructional design, project management, and adult learning principles, often supported by a bachelor’s or master’s degree in education, HR, or a related field. Familiarity with Learning Management Systems (LMS), e-learning authoring tools, and relevant certifications like CPLP or ATD are typically required. Strong communication, leadership, and analytical skills help you collaborate across teams and tailor programs to organizational needs. These skills and qualities are crucial to designing effective learning solutions that drive employee growth and achieve business objectives.

Job Description

The Manager of Learning & Development leads the design, delivery, and continuous improvement of learning programs that support both retail and corporate teams. This role develops scalable onboarding, leadership development, operational training, and professional development programs that strengthen performance, improve execution, and support company growth. This Manager partners closely with business leaders to build learning solutions that drive engagement, capability, and results.

Responsibilities

Learning Strategy & Development

  • Develop and execute the company's learning and development strategy across retail and corporate teams
  • Identify development needs and create learning solutions aligned with business priorities
  • Design and maintain onboarding, leadership development, operational, compliance, and professional development programs
  • Measure learning effectiveness and continuously improve programs based on feedback and business results

Retail Learning & Field Development

  • Create training programs that improve leadership capability, customer service, merchandising, and operational execution
  • Support new store openings, acquisitions, and major operational initiatives through structured training plans
  • Partner with field leaders to reinforce learning and ensure consistent execution across stores
  • Develop tools and resources that support Store Managers, District Managers, and Regional Directors

Corporate Learning & Talent Development

  • Lead onboarding and development programs for corporate team members
  • Partner with department leaders to improve role readiness, process adoption, and team effectiveness
  • Facilitate workshops, leadership programs, and development sessions for leaders and emerging talent
  • Support succession planning and talent development initiatives in partnership with Human Resources

Learning Technology & Content Management

  • Manage the Learning Management System, including course administration, reporting, and compliance tracking
  • Oversee the development of instructor-led, digital, and LMS-based learning content
  • Utilize AI-enabled tools and learning technologies to improve the efficiency, quality, and scalability of training
  • Maintain training content to ensure accuracy, consistency, and alignment with company standards

Skills and Knowledge

Ability to develop talent and build high-performing teams, Continuous improvement mindset with strong problem-solving abilities, Proficiency with AI tools and modern content development technologies, Strategic thinking and planning skills with strong attention to priorities, Strong communication, organization, and stakeholder management skills, Strong instructional design, facilitation, and project management skills

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ree in Human Resources, Business, Education, Organizational Development, or related field preferred
  • 5+ years of experience in Learning & Development, Training, Organizational Development, or Retail Operations
  • Experience supporting both field and corporate populations preferred
  • Experience with Learning Management Systems and digital learning platforms
  • Retail or multi-unit experience preferred
